Grant Overview
Innovative Transportation Solutions for Disabled Individuals
This grant will support the development and implementation of transportation services that specifically address the unique challenges faced by people with disabilities. In recent years, there has been an increased focus on enhancing mobility for disabled individuals, driven by a recognition of the crucial role that access to transportation plays in overall life quality. Unlike typical transportation grants that may focus solely on infrastructure, this initiative is targeted at creating innovative, affordable transportation solutions tailored to the needs of disabled individuals.
The program could include the introduction of app-based transportation services that enable on-demand rides, giving disabled individuals the ability to access essential services and participate in community events. For example, a transportation service that prioritizes low-income clients and ensures vehicles are equipped with necessary accommodations could significantly improve access and independence. Furthermore, successful pilot programs in similar regions can be leveraged to illustrate viability and effectiveness.
Organizations that should apply for this funding include those providing transportation services or developmental programs specifically for disabled individuals. In contrast, projects that do not incorporate accessibility features or that lack a focus on affordability for low-income clients may not meet the eligibility criteria.
To ensure alignment with funding requirements, applicants need to demonstrate their understanding of community mobility challenges and an innovative approach to solving them. This includes outlining the technological capabilities to sustain operations, and any partnerships with local clinics, schools, or communities to enhance outreach and service utilization.
